Abortion in the American imagination : before life and choice, 1880-1940 / Karen Weingarten.
"Abortion is one of the most contentious issues in contemporary American politics, yet since Roe v. Wade the terms of the debate have remained fairly static. The early decades of the twentieth century, however, saw the emergence of a new rhetoric surrounding abortion and a proliferation of nove...
